NiSource and Sempra Energy, two leading energy companies, are making significant strides in the field of hydrogen blending. As the world transitions towards cleaner and more sustainable energy sources, hydrogen is emerging as a promising alternative to traditional fossil fuels. NiSource and Sempra Energy are at the forefront of this movement, exploring the potential of hydrogen blending to reduce carbon emissions and create a greener future.<\/p>\n

Hydrogen blending involves mixing hydrogen with natural gas in existing pipelines, allowing for a gradual integration of hydrogen into the existing infrastructure. This process offers several advantages, including the ability to leverage existing pipeline networks, reduce carbon emissions, and provide a smooth transition towards a hydrogen-based energy system.<\/p>\n

NiSource, a Fortune 500 company based in Indiana, is actively involved in hydrogen blending initiatives. The company has partnered with various stakeholders, including government agencies, research institutions, and other energy companies, to explore the feasibility and benefits of blending hydrogen into its natural gas distribution system. NiSource aims to blend up to 20% hydrogen by volume into its pipeline system by 2030, significantly reducing carbon emissions and contributing to a cleaner energy future.<\/p>\n

Hydrogen blending offers numerous environmental benefits. When hydrogen is burned, it produces only water vapor as a byproduct, making it a clean and emissions-free energy source. By blending hydrogen into natural gas, carbon emissions can be significantly reduced, contributing to the fight against climate change. Additionally, hydrogen blending can help to improve air quality by reducing the release of pollutants associated with traditional fossil fuels.<\/p>\n

However, challenges remain in the widespread adoption of hydrogen blending. One major obstacle is the availability and cost of hydrogen production. Currently, most hydrogen is produced from fossil fuels, which undermines its environmental benefits. To fully realize the potential of hydrogen blending, there is a need for increased investment in renewable hydrogen production technologies, such as electrolysis powered by renewable energy sources.<\/p>\n
